Victory4All – Jeffrey’s Bay
In the slums of Jeffrey’s Bay, around 800 children receive quality education and daily discipleship. The schools and community projects of Victory4All demonstrate how hope and opportunity can transform lives. As hosts of the conference, they shared their experience and served as an inspiring example for other nations.
Schools of Hope – Myanmar
In Myanmar, where attending school can be dangerous for many children, HiKidz provides safe education through trained volunteers in local churches. In small groups of about 20 children, they learn to read and write while receiving biblical teaching and discipleship. The network has grown to around 150 schools and continues to expand each year.
Biblical Curriculum – Brazil
Children Asking presented a primary school curriculum built on seven biblical foundations. The curriculum is already being used in around 50 locations across Brazil and is now being introduced in other Portuguese-speaking countries.
Homeschooling – WLearn Academy
WLearn Academy shared its digital homeschooling program, developed with the Gospel at its heart. After successful pilot projects in Ghana, the program is being prepared to support children and families in many more countries.
